    Dwight Howard's face might have been stinging from Kevin Garnett ramming his head into it, and now his ears were ringing as fans directed loud boos toward him.

    Howard wasn't tempted to silence them by demanding the ball at the expense of Houston's offense. He was after a win, not revenge.

    "As long as we win the game, that's all that matters," Howard said. "We've got 82 games and the playoffs. I'll do my damage when it's time."

    James Harden scored 30 points, carrying Houston on a night when Howard did little after fighting with Garnett, and the Rockets beat the slumping Brooklyn Nets 113-99 on Monday.
